The Co-op’s Expansion - The future for ethical trading Print E-mail
There was great news for the Co-op who has just announced that they have bought 64 convenience stores in the south-west for £25m.

Might this be a pat on the back from consumers for their ethical trading stance? Are retail businesses which include Saveasari in this growing area being rewarded?

The Co-op has 40 department stores and 15 supermarkets nationwide, and is in the process of trialling a new department store format. We await the results of the trial eagerly and have a suggestion for them. Why don’t they trial new young designers as concessions in their department stores? An ethical commitment to the community which sustains and develops new talent!
